Most of it is held on there with double sided stickey tape.
The little pieces behind the doors, I can't remember if it's the ones in front of or behind the rear wheels or both, are held on by bolts. You have to tear out the interior to get at them. And the bits on the front and rear bumpers are molded right into the bumper cover.

I think there is paint underneath

If you are thinking of taking it off for a different look I wouldn't bother, you won't be happy with it and cause you can't take it off the bumpers it won't look right.
